Electrical Wiring Cost in Texas (2026)
Average Electrical Wiring Cost in Texas
$3,587
Low End
$2,390
Average
$3,587
High End
$4,754

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does electrical wiring cost in Texas?
Electrical Wiring in Texas typically costs between $2,390 and $4,754, with an average of $3,587 for a typical project in 2026.
Is electrical wiring more expensive in Texas than the national average?
Yes, electrical wiring in Texas is about 2% above the national average due to local labor costs and market conditions.
Do I need a permit for electrical wiring in Texas?
Permit requirements vary by city and county in Texas. Most electrical wiring projects that involve structural changes require a building permit. Check our permit guide for Texas for specific requirements.
How long does electrical wiring take in Texas?
A typical electrical wiring project takes 2-7 days depending on the scope, weather conditions, and contractor availability in your area.
How can I save money on electrical wiring in Texas?
Get at least 3 quotes from licensed contractors, consider scheduling during off-peak seasons (fall/winter), ask about financing options, and make sure to compare material options as they significantly affect the total cost.
